Curtains Egham

1 - 2 of 2 listings
Listings
  • Terris Curtains & Blinds

    Terris Curtains & BlindsPremium

    Category: Curtains - Location: Egham (London)

    Curtains, fabrics, interiors, Egham, England, AB32, Surrey

  • Trends

    TrendsPremium

    Category: Curtains - Location: Egham (London)

    Curtains, fabrics, interiors, Egham, England, BT71, Surrey